PRIMARY PURPOSE OF POSITION

A highly experienced litigation and bankruptcy attorney who works independently and has major matter, team or client responsibilities.

Work generally involves handling matters of very substantial importance.

PRIMARY DUTIES AND ACCOUNTABILITIES

  • Performs as a specialist in the litigation and bankruptcy fields of law, provides technical and expert legal services to Constellation Business Units.
  • Under little or no supervision, plans, conducts and supervises large and highly complex legal assignments; evaluates both legal and business risks and advises clients accordingly;

represents Constellation in litigation or other relevant matters. Provides legal counsel to all levels of management, including senior management.

  • Directly manages relationships and matters with Business Units and outside counsel. Provides project leadership direction to support staff.
  • Prepare, and revise as necessary, budgets and early matter assessments for all matters involving outside counsel.
  • Projects / duties as assigned.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S

  • An LLB or JD from an accredited law school and be licensed to practice law.
  • At least 10-12 years of professional experience in a specialized area of law.
  • Possesses and applies a comprehensive knowledge of principles, practices and procedures of the legal field to the completion of complex assignments.
  • Requires excellent legal research, analytical abilities and on ongoing knowledge of federal and / or state law, including bankruptcy law
